Webreduction of opioid overdose deaths. This funding to Texas was the second highest amount awarded in the nation based on unmet treatment needs and overdose death rates. For fiscal years 2024 and 2024, SAMHSA awarded HHSC $46.2 million annually in SOR grant funding to support a comprehensive response to the opioid epidemic in Texas (TTOR, 2024).

Penalty Group 1 drugs are classified by … WebJan 1, 2024 · Texas had 2,588 drug overdose deaths in 2015, a rate of 9.4 per 100,000 residents, one of the lowest in the country. But Hill says Texas likely undercounts overdoses. Only 13 of Texas’ 254 counties enlist a medical examiner to determine the cause of death when a person dies outside of a health care setting.
